Applied Materials is a global leader in materials engineering solutions used to produce virtually every new chip and advanced display in the world. We design build and service cutting-edge equipment that helps our customers manufacture display and semiconductor chips the brains of devices we use every day. As the foundation of the global electronics industry Applied enables the exciting technologies that literally connect our world like AI and IoT. Key Responsibilities

CVD continuous improvement on qualification tests evaluation of coated NSF mura free GT.
1. Support CVD gap sensor development and continuous improvement activities
2. Assist with sensor qualification testing and data analysis
3. Conduct performance evaluation and document findings for engineering review

PVD In house test
Develop a smart golf tee capable of detecting glass breakage sticking temperature changes and deformation through multisensor integration.

Final Project Review
1. Interns will deliver a 30minute English presentation on their projects.
2. Managers will evaluate each interns R&D capability and those who demonstrate outstanding performance may be considered for an early offer.

Requirements Skill

Skill : Strong communication in English ( (Toeic 750) Finite element analysis (numerical method) AutoCAD 2022 Creo 4.0 and Ansys 2023
Knowledge : Engineering mechanics vacuum system and plasma sputtering
Experience : Club/Student committee members preferred
Education (Major/Degree) : Mechanical Engineering Masters degree preferred
